Mauritania's Maritime Fisheries Code (Loi n° 2015-017 of 29 July 2015) does not name spearfishing / underwater fishing (pêche sous-marine, chasse au harpon) as a distinct, regulated activity. The closest category is 'pêche sportive' (sport fishing), which Article 6 allows only for non-commercial recreational purposes, using gear whose composition and conditions of use are defined by an order (arrêté) of the Minister in charge of fisheries, and only in zones the Minister has designated. No publicly retrievable ministerial order specifically authorising or framing recreational spearfishing was found, so the practical legality is treated as restricted/unclear. General prohibitions apply: use of explosives or toxic substances is banned (Art. 38), and the capture/retention of all marine mammals, marine turtles and all seabird species is prohibited everywhere (Art. 39). The most important coastal areas — the Banc d'Arguin National Park (UNESCO World Heritage, est. 1976) and the Diawling National Park — bar modern/recreational fishing and motorboats; in the Banc d'Arguin only the indigenous Imraguen community may fish, using sail boats and traditional gear. Recreational spearfishing by tourists/foreigners is not documented as a permitted, licensed activity, and the marine national parks effectively prohibit it within their boundaries.

Types of fishing — sport (recreational) fishing definition and conditions
Loi n° 2015-017 du 29 juillet 2015 portant Code des Pêches Maritimes
Article 6 : La pêche peut avoir pour finalité a) la subsistance ; b) le commerce ; c) l'exploration; d) la recherche scientifique ou technique; e) le sport. [...] La pêche sportive est pratiquée sans but lucratif à des fins récréatives avec un matériel dont la composition et les modalités d'utilisation sont définies par arrêté du ministre chargé des pêches, dans les zones qu'il aura fixées. Les types de pêche peuvent être distingués en fonction des techniques utilisées, des espèces ciblées ou des zones où la pêche est pratiquée. Les types de pêche sont définis par décret pris en Conseil des Ministres sur rapport du Ministre chargé des pêches.
Prohibition of explosives and toxic substances in fishing
Loi n° 2015-017 du 29 juillet 2015 portant Code des Pêches Maritimes
Article 38 : Il est expressément interdit, sauf autorisation spéciale du ministre chargé des pêches, de a) faire usage, dans l'exercice de la pêche, de matières explosives ou de substances toxiques susceptibles d'affaiblir, étourdir, exciter ou tuer des poissons ou de polluer le milieu marin ; b) détenir à bord des navires de pêche des matières et substances mentionnées à l'alinéa précédent.
Protection of certain species (marine mammals, turtles, seabirds)
Loi n° 2015-017 du 29 juillet 2015 portant Code des Pêches Maritimes
Article 39 : Sont interdits en tout temps et en tout lieu, sauf autorisation spéciale du ministre chargé des pêches et à des fins de recherche scientifique ou technique a) la pêche, la capture et la détention de toutes espèces de mammifères marins ; b) la pêche, la capture et la détention des tortues marines ; c) la chasse, la capture, la détention de toutes espèces d'oiseaux marins; d) la pêche, la capture ou la rétention des animaux aquatiques faisant l'objet d'une restriction particulière prévue par les textes en vigueur. La commercialisation des espèces visées aux alinéas ci-dessus est interdite.
Serious offences — fishing in prohibited zones or with prohibited gear/technique
Loi n° 2015-017 du 29 juillet 2015 portant Code des Pêches Maritimes
c) la pêche dans les zones interdites ou avec des engins de pêche ou technique prohibée ; d) la détention à bord le transport ou l'emploi d'explosifs ou autres substances toxiques ou non autorisées, ou de tous moyens ou dispositifs ayant pour effet de réduire l'action sélective des engins de pêche ;

Takmarkanir
- Explosives and toxic substances are prohibited in fishing (Art. 38).
- Sport-fishing gear ('matériel') composition and conditions of use must be defined by ministerial order (arrêté) (Art. 6); no such order specific to spearfishing was located.
The Maritime Fisheries Code (Loi 2015-017) does not explicitly mention spearguns (fusil sous-marin), harpoons (harpon) or scuba; their permissibility for recreational spearfishing is therefore unknown and subject to ministerial regulation and protected-area bans.

Bannaðar svæðar
- Banc d'Arguin National Park (Parc National du Banc d'Arguin)national park / UNESCO World Heritage marine protected area
West Africa's largest marine protected area (~12,000 km2), established 1976, UNESCO World Heritage Site (1989) and Ramsar wetland (1982). Only the indigenous Imraguen community may fish within park boundaries, using relatively primitive techniques and tools; no motorboats are permitted and modern fishing gear is banned. Recreational/sport spearfishing is not permitted.
- Diawling National Park (Parc National du Diawling)national park / Ramsar wetland
National park established 1991 in the Senegal River delta of south-west Mauritania (~16,000 ha), Ramsar wetland (1994), part of a trans-border biosphere reserve. Fishing is regulated and limited to managed sustainable use by local communities; recreational spearfishing is not documented as permitted.

Spearfishing is not addressed as a named activity in Mauritanian law. The Maritime Fisheries Code (Loi 2015-017, Art. 6) only provides a generic 'pêche sportive' (sport fishing) category whose gear and authorised zones must be set by a ministerial order (arrêté) that was not retrievable online; therefore the concrete legality of recreational spearfishing (speargun/harpoon, with or without scuba) is genuinely unclear and is recorded as 'restricted'. Verbatim French text of Articles 6, 38 and 39 and the offences list was extracted directly from the official FAOLEX PDF of the law (pdftotext); a few OCR artifacts in the source PDF were corrected to the obvious standard legal French (e.g. 'à des fins récréatives'). The most relevant coastal areas (Banc d'Arguin and Diawling national parks) bar modern/recreational and motorised fishing, so practical recreational spearfishing access along the prime Mauritanian coast is heavily constrained. data_confidence is 'low' because no spearfishing-specific instrument, no recreational licence schedule, and no closed-season schedule for recreational fishing could be located; only the general framework law and protected-area rules are confirmed.
